Bishop Daniel Obinim, the General Overseer of the International Godsway Church has revealed that the conflict with lawmaker Kennedy Agyapong was resolved unexpectedly upon discovering their blood relation.
He mentioned that despite their past clash over Agyapong’s investigations into churches and fraudulent pastors, including Obinim’s church, he felt compelled to forgive him.
Mr Agyapong has been consistently calling him a brother in various media appearances lately, which led him to look into the validity of these statements.
Subsequently, his father confirmed that he and Mr Agyapong are indeed related. Speaking to his congregation during a Sunday church service, Obinim said;
“To my astonishment, I learned that Kennedy Agyapong and I are indeed blood relatives. On one occasion, he publicly referred to me as his brother, expressing regret for his actions had he known of our familial ties. This led me to inquire with my father, who confirmed our relationship, explaining that his elder brother was married to Kennedy Agyapong’s mother. The news took me by surprise,” Obinim shared.
“I recall the recent passing of Kennedy Agyapong’s father. I was the first to break the news, even before Kennedy himself. It was at that moment that I fully forgave him. His well-being matters to me, and we have since reconciled. Although at that time, I requested my name be removed from the obituary and funeral program,” he added.
